mum_and_child_photo_265Since 1991, SOS Children’s Villages Mauritius, has been on the forefront as an NGO to protect and fulfil the rights of our most disadvantaged children for a family and the love of a mother. It operates two SOS children’s villages, and the programme supports some 700 beneficiaries.

Besides residential care, its core activity, the organisation also provides outreach community-based services for the prevention of child abandonment.

SOS Children’s Villages Mauritius relies on the support of individuals, companies, government grants, foundations and other funding institutions to help children.

It is affiliated to SOS-Kinderdorf International, the umbrella organisation for all SOS children’s villages associations around the world, founded by Hermann Gmeiner.

 

Quick Look
  • Number of Family Houses for kids under 15 years: 21
  • Number of children at full capacity in all Family Houses: 140
  • Average number of children per Family House: 7
  • Number of youths at present capacity for Youth Houses: 30
  • Available seats for kids in the kindergartens (pre-schools): 160 at SOS CV Beau Bassin, and 75 at SOS CV Bambous
  • Remedial education depends upon needs of kids
  • Number of adolescents at full capacity in Vocational Education and Training (VET): 20
  • SOS Children’s Villages Mauritius is a member of SOS Kinderdorf International (SOS KDI)
  • A board comprising benevolent individuals of the private sector and representatives of the government and SOS-KDI governs the organisation
